.industry-hero[data-astro-cid-zn3acpsv]{position:relative;height:844px;background:linear-gradient(#00000059,#0000008c),radial-gradient(ellipse at 80% 30%,rgba(5,95,89,.45) 0%,transparent 55%),linear-gradient(180deg,#001a17,#000);border-bottom:1px solid rgba(255,255,255,.14);overflow:hidden;color:#fff}@media(min-width:768px){.industry-hero[data-astro-cid-zn3acpsv]{height:900px}}.industry-hero-grid[data-astro-cid-zn3acpsv]{position:absolute;inset:0;pointer-events:none;z-index:2}.industry-hero-vline[data-astro-cid-zn3acpsv]{position:absolute;top:0;bottom:0;width:1px;background:linear-gradient(180deg,#fff0,#fff9 14.9%,#fff0,#fff9 85.1%,#fff0)}.industry-hero-vline[data-astro-cid-zn3acpsv].left{left:288px}.industry-hero-vline[data-astro-cid-zn3acpsv].right{right:288px}.industry-hero-hline[data-astro-cid-zn3acpsv]{position:absolute;left:0;right:0;height:1px;background:linear-gradient(90deg,#fff9,#fff0,#fff9)}.industry-hero-hline[data-astro-cid-zn3acpsv].top{top:134px}.industry-hero-hline[data-astro-cid-zn3acpsv].bottom{bottom:224px}.industry-hero-cross[data-astro-cid-zn3acpsv]{position:absolute;width:24px;height:24px;transform:translate(-50%,-50%)}.industry-hero-cross[data-astro-cid-zn3acpsv]:before,.industry-hero-cross[data-astro-cid-zn3acpsv]:after{content:"";position:absolute;background:#fff}.industry-hero-cross[data-astro-cid-zn3acpsv]:before{left:0;right:0;top:50%;height:1px;transform:translateY(-50%)}.industry-hero-cross[data-astro-cid-zn3acpsv]:after{top:0;bottom:0;left:50%;width:1px;transform:translate(-50%)}.industry-hero-cross[data-astro-cid-zn3acpsv].top-left{top:134px;left:288px}.industry-hero-cross[data-astro-cid-zn3acpsv].top-right{top:134px;right:288px;transform:translate(50%,-50%)}.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-left{bottom:224px;left:288px;transform:translate(-50%,50%)}.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-right{bottom:224px;right:288px;transform:translate(50%,50%)}.industry-hero-bracket[data-astro-cid-zn3acpsv]{position:absolute;top:134px;left:288px;padding:32px 0 0 24px;z-index:3;pointer-events:none}.industry-hero-bracket[data-astro-cid-zn3acpsv] span[data-astro-cid-zn3acpsv]{font-family:Inter,sans-serif;font-size:12px;letter-spacing:.18em;text-transform:uppercase;color:#ffffffd9;white-space:nowrap}.industry-hero-stage[data-astro-cid-zn3acpsv]{position:absolute;inset:134px 288px 224px;z-index:3;display:flex;flex-direction:column;justify-content:space-between;padding:28px 24px 24px}.industry-hero-breadcrumb[data-astro-cid-zn3acpsv]{font-family:Inter,sans-serif;font-size:11px;letter-spacing:.18em;text-transform:uppercase;color:#ffffff80;display:inline-flex;align-items:center;gap:10px}.industry-hero-breadcrumb[data-astro-cid-zn3acpsv] a[data-astro-cid-zn3acpsv]{color:#ffffff80;text-decoration:none;transition:color .18s ease}.industry-hero-breadcrumb[data-astro-cid-zn3acpsv] a[data-astro-cid-zn3acpsv]:hover,.industry-hero-breadcrumb-current[data-astro-cid-zn3acpsv]{color:#fff}.industry-hero-content[data-astro-cid-zn3acpsv]{display:flex;flex-direction:column;gap:4px}.industry-hero-line1[data-astro-cid-zn3acpsv]{display:flex;align-items:center;gap:32px}.industry-hero-title[data-astro-cid-zn3acpsv]{font-family:"Instrument Serif",Georgia,serif;font-size:clamp(40px,8vw,80px);line-height:1;letter-spacing:-.015em;color:#fcfcfd;white-space:nowrap}.industry-hero-italic[data-astro-cid-zn3acpsv]{font-style:italic}.industry-hero-rule[data-astro-cid-zn3acpsv]{flex:1;height:1px;max-width:360px;background:#ffffff8c}.industry-hero-line2[data-astro-cid-zn3acpsv]{text-align:right}.industry-hero-sub[data-astro-cid-zn3acpsv]{margin:56px 0 0 auto;max-width:480px;text-align:right;font-family:Inter,sans-serif;font-size:16px;line-height:1.55;color:#ffffffb3}@media(max-width:1279px){.industry-hero-vline[data-astro-cid-zn3acpsv].left,.industry-hero-cross[data-astro-cid-zn3acpsv].top-left,.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-left{left:160px}.industry-hero-vline[data-astro-cid-zn3acpsv].right,.industry-hero-cross[data-astro-cid-zn3acpsv].top-right,.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-right{right:160px}.industry-hero-bracket[data-astro-cid-zn3acpsv]{left:160px}.industry-hero-stage[data-astro-cid-zn3acpsv]{left:160px;right:160px}}@media(max-width:1023px){.industry-hero-vline[data-astro-cid-zn3acpsv].left,.industry-hero-cross[data-astro-cid-zn3acpsv].top-left,.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-left{left:80px}.industry-hero-vline[data-astro-cid-zn3acpsv].right,.industry-hero-cross[data-astro-cid-zn3acpsv].top-right,.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-right{right:80px}.industry-hero-hline[data-astro-cid-zn3acpsv].top,.industry-hero-cross[data-astro-cid-zn3acpsv].top-left,.industry-hero-cross[data-astro-cid-zn3acpsv].top-right{top:120px}.industry-hero-hline[data-astro-cid-zn3acpsv].bottom,.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-left,.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-right{bottom:210px}.industry-hero-bracket[data-astro-cid-zn3acpsv]{left:80px;top:120px}.industry-hero-stage[data-astro-cid-zn3acpsv]{inset:120px 80px 210px;padding:56px 20px 20px}.industry-hero-line1[data-astro-cid-zn3acpsv]{gap:16px}.industry-hero-rule[data-astro-cid-zn3acpsv]{max-width:80px}.industry-hero-sub[data-astro-cid-zn3acpsv]{margin:24px 0 0;max-width:100%;text-align:left;font-size:14px}.industry-hero-line2[data-astro-cid-zn3acpsv]{text-align:left}}@media(max-width:767px){.industry-hero[data-astro-cid-zn3acpsv]{height:720px!important}.industry-hero-vline[data-astro-cid-zn3acpsv].left,.industry-hero-cross[data-astro-cid-zn3acpsv].top-left,.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-left{left:16px!important;display:block!important}.industry-hero-vline[data-astro-cid-zn3acpsv].right,.industry-hero-cross[data-astro-cid-zn3acpsv].top-right,.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-right{right:16px!important;display:block!important}.industry-hero-cross[data-astro-cid-zn3acpsv]{width:16px!important;height:16px!important}.industry-hero-hline[data-astro-cid-zn3acpsv].top{top:109px!important}.industry-hero-hline[data-astro-cid-zn3acpsv].bottom{bottom:96px!important}.industry-hero-cross[data-astro-cid-zn3acpsv].top-left,.industry-hero-cross[data-astro-cid-zn3acpsv].top-right{top:109px!important}.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-left,.industry-hero-cross[data-astro-cid-zn3acpsv].bottom-right{bottom:96px!important}.industry-hero-bracket[data-astro-cid-zn3acpsv]{top:109px!important;left:16px!important;padding:24px 0 0 24px!important}.industry-hero-bracket[data-astro-cid-zn3acpsv] span[data-astro-cid-zn3acpsv]{font-size:11px!important}.industry-hero-stage[data-astro-cid-zn3acpsv]{inset:109px 16px 96px!important;padding:64px 24px 24px!important;gap:16px!important;justify-content:flex-start!important}.industry-hero-line1[data-astro-cid-zn3acpsv]{flex-wrap:wrap!important;gap:12px!important;margin-bottom:0!important}.industry-hero-title[data-astro-cid-zn3acpsv]{white-space:normal!important;font-size:clamp(32px,9vw,48px)!important}.industry-hero-rule[data-astro-cid-zn3acpsv]{display:none!important}.industry-hero-line2[data-astro-cid-zn3acpsv]{text-align:left!important}.industry-hero-sub[data-astro-cid-zn3acpsv]{margin:12px 0 0!important;max-width:100%!important;text-align:left!important;font-size:13px!important}.industry-hero-breadcrumb[data-astro-cid-zn3acpsv]{font-size:10px}}.ind-answer-grid[data-astro-cid-zn3acpsv]{display:grid;grid-template-columns:300px 1fr;gap:56px;align-items:flex-start}.ind-tldr-grid[data-astro-cid-zn3acpsv]{display:grid;grid-template-columns:180px 1fr;gap:40px;align-items:flex-start}.ind-tldr-cells[data-astro-cid-zn3acpsv]{display:grid;grid-template-columns:repeat(5,1fr);gap:0}.ind-partners-grid[data-astro-cid-zn3acpsv]{display:grid;grid-template-columns:220px 1fr;gap:40px;align-items:center}.ind-faq[data-astro-cid-zn3acpsv][open] .ind-faq-toggle[data-astro-cid-zn3acpsv]{transform:rotate(45deg)}.ind-faq-toggle[data-astro-cid-zn3acpsv]{display:inline-block;transition:transform .22s ease}.ind-faq[data-astro-cid-zn3acpsv] summary[data-astro-cid-zn3acpsv]::-webkit-details-marker{display:none}.ind-comp-head[data-astro-cid-zn3acpsv],.ind-comp-row[data-astro-cid-zn3acpsv]{min-width:880px}@media(max-width:1023px){.ind-comp-head[data-astro-cid-zn3acpsv],.ind-comp-row[data-astro-cid-zn3acpsv]{min-width:auto!important;grid-template-columns:1fr!important;gap:6px!important;padding:16px 20px!important}.ind-comp-head[data-astro-cid-zn3acpsv]{display:none!important}}@media(max-width:1100px){.ind-tldr-cells[data-astro-cid-zn3acpsv]{grid-template-columns:repeat(2,1fr)!important;gap:24px 16px!important}.ind-tldr-cell[data-astro-cid-zn3acpsv]{border-left:none!important}.ind-pain-row[data-astro-cid-zn3acpsv],.ind-pain-head[data-astro-cid-zn3acpsv],.ind-engage-row[data-astro-cid-zn3acpsv],.ind-compliance-row[data-astro-cid-zn3acpsv]{grid-template-columns:1fr!important;gap:8px!important}.ind-practices[data-astro-cid-zn3acpsv],.ind-accelerators[data-astro-cid-zn3acpsv],.ind-children[data-astro-cid-zn3acpsv]{grid-template-columns:1fr 1fr!important}.ind-practice-cell[data-astro-cid-zn3acpsv]:nth-child(2n),.ind-accel-cell[data-astro-cid-zn3acpsv]:nth-child(2n),.ind-child-cell[data-astro-cid-zn3acpsv]:nth-child(2n){border-right:none!important}}@media(max-width:767px){.ind-answer[data-astro-cid-zn3acpsv]{padding:36px 20px 32px!important}.ind-answer-grid[data-astro-cid-zn3acpsv]{grid-template-columns:1fr!important;gap:16px!important}.ind-tldr[data-astro-cid-zn3acpsv]{padding:28px 20px!important}.ind-tldr-grid[data-astro-cid-zn3acpsv]{grid-template-columns:1fr!important;gap:20px!important}.ind-tldr-cells[data-astro-cid-zn3acpsv]{grid-template-columns:1fr!important;gap:18px!important}.ind-tldr-cell[data-astro-cid-zn3acpsv]{padding:0!important}.ind-thesis-split[data-astro-cid-zn3acpsv]{grid-template-columns:1fr!important}.ind-thesis-cell[data-astro-cid-zn3acpsv]{border-right:none!important;border-bottom:1px solid rgba(255,255,255,.14);padding:28px 20px!important}.ind-thesis-cell[data-astro-cid-zn3acpsv]:last-child{border-bottom:none}.ind-practices[data-astro-cid-zn3acpsv],.ind-accelerators[data-astro-cid-zn3acpsv],.ind-children[data-astro-cid-zn3acpsv]{grid-template-columns:1fr!important}.ind-practice-cell[data-astro-cid-zn3acpsv],.ind-accel-cell[data-astro-cid-zn3acpsv],.ind-child-cell[data-astro-cid-zn3acpsv]{border-right:none!important;border-bottom:1px solid rgba(255,255,255,.14);min-height:auto!important}.ind-practice-cell[data-astro-cid-zn3acpsv]:last-child,.ind-accel-cell[data-astro-cid-zn3acpsv]:last-child,.ind-child-cell[data-astro-cid-zn3acpsv]:last-child{border-bottom:none}.ind-proof[data-astro-cid-zn3acpsv]{grid-template-columns:1fr!important}.ind-proof-headline[data-astro-cid-zn3acpsv]{padding:28px 20px!important;min-height:auto!important}.ind-proof-support[data-astro-cid-zn3acpsv]{border-left:none!important;border-top:1px solid rgba(255,255,255,.14)}.ind-partners[data-astro-cid-zn3acpsv]{padding:32px 20px!important}.ind-partners-grid[data-astro-cid-zn3acpsv]{grid-template-columns:1fr!important;gap:18px!important}}
